North Vermillion had won six straight home games and Teagan Leonard did his part to make it seven on Saturday. The North Vermillion Falcons came out on top against the Schlarman Hilltoppers by a score of 73-60 thanks in part to Leonard, who went 11 for 15 on his way to 34 points and five boards. The game was his tenth in a row with at least ten points.
Owen Edwards was another key player, putting up five points and three blocks. The dominant performance gave him a new career-high in blocks.
North Vermillion has been performing incredibly well recently as they've won nine of their last ten matches, which provided a nice bump to their 11-3 record this season. Those victories came thanks to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they averaged 71.4 points per game. As for Schlarman, this is the second loss in a row for them and nudges their season record down to 5-9.
Both teams are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. North Vermillion will welcome Parke Heritage at 7:30 p.m. on Friday. Parke Heritage will roll in looking for their eighth straight victory, something North Vermillion surely won't give up without a fight. As for Schlarman, they will have a little extra prep time after the loss as they won't be playing again for a while. They'll take on Chrisman at 6:00 p.m. on January 28th.
